Before the incident
Pulling inmate back into chair holding inmate 's wrists
What happened
Employee was holding inmate 's wrists when arresting officer pulled inmate from the chair and employee 's finger got jammed with back of the chair
Injury or illness
Middle finger of right hand is sore and in pain when griping items
Object or substance involved
Jamming finger on chair
Summary line
While pulling cuffed inmate back into chair inmate 's hands were placed behind the chair. Employee was holding inmate 's wrists when arresting officer pulled inmate from the chair. Employee 's finger got jammed with back of chair
